CAFFE satisfied with polls

Published:Tuesday | March 24, 2009 | 8:40 AM

Election observer group Citizens For Free And Fair Elections (CAFFE) said its generally satisfied with the conduct of the polls.



CAFFE Chairman Dr. Loyd Barnett said the election proceedings took place without any major problems.



Dr. Barnett is however suggesting that the EOJ may need to have its workers become more familiar with the use of the electronic voter identification system.
